Migration to ODI 14

The Challenge

Many organizations encounter significant challenges when migrating their Oracle Data Integrator (ODI) environments from earlier versions (ODI 10, ODI 11, ODI 12) to the latest release, ODI 14 (December 2024). Experience shows that standard upgrade procedures using the Oracle Upgrade Assistant (UA) alone may lead to complications. These issues often emerge during initial testing phases or, even more critically, in subsequent development activities.

In particular, ODI Mappings and Interfaces pose substantial difficulties due to structural changes introduced in recent ODI versions. These elements require careful handling to avoid long-term inefficiencies in your data integration workflows.

How Our Migration Process Works

Our procedure follows Oracle’s recommended migration approach, enriched by additional custom tooling developed by D&T:

  • Asking the Customer to provide all involved data schemas objects (tables, views) without data, empty structures only.
  • Asking the Customer to provide an export of the projects that have to be migrated (Smart Export or Data Pump)
  • Creating the provided empty data schemas in our laboratory.
  • Importing the exported projects in our laboratory.
  • Run Oracle’s Upgrade Assistant (UA) to upgrade your existing repository.
  • Addressing and solving all issues that might have been generated by the upgrading assistant.
  • Testing all migrated objects by running them in our laboratory against the empty structures. Fix all issues in case.
  • Export previously deleted ODI Packages using Oracle’s Smart Export utility from the original schema.
  • Re-import these ODI Packages into the ODI 14 environment using Oracle’s Smart Import utility, configuring it to utilize the newly created ODI Mappings seamlessly.

Upon completing these steps, your ODI environment is fully migrated to ODI 14.
